Welcome to the safety and acceptance of my counseling space. I bring over twenty years of experience as a Licensed Professional Counselor and a Mental Health Service Provider. I also bring experience as a training supervisor of those aspiring to be counselors. As a provider who has also sat in the client’s chair in therapy, I bring an understanding of the importance of trust in this very special relationship, which for me, is founded in the belief of dignity and respect for all. Over the years I have studied my craft extensively, and I have honed my counseling skills in concentrated work in education and with psychiatrists, mentors, and other counselors. Yet, it is my work with my clients that has given me the greatest understanding of my purpose as a counseling professional and my place as a support for those clients as they address issues and work to find meaning in the journey. My skills are best employed in individual counseling where I rely on a variety of theories including psycho-dynamic and compassion-focused. I employ a variety of interventions from
these two theories, and other theories that work with individual clients.

Specific areas of focus and experience:

Anxiety, Depression, and Bipolar Disorder in adults and children;

Anger issues in adults and children;

Substance Abuse issues in adults;

Adults abused as children and reparenting

Transitions and impasses in developmental stages;

Mindfulness, guided relaxation, stress reduction, and breathing exercises;

Member, Self-Compassion Community of Kristen Neff

Affirming of all;
